Common to older Dutch homes is a narrow, separated kitchen parallel to the dining room. The first thing the couple did was knock out part of a wall to bring in more light and to create a more open living space. Then they had new floors laid throughout, opting for light-coloured wood to emphasise the natural light that floods through the room’s large sash windows (one of the features they fell in love with when they first saw the house).
